当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云服务器怎么搭建网站的,阿里云服务器搭建网站全攻略,从入门到精通

阿里云服务器怎么搭建网站的,阿里云服务器搭建网站全攻略,从入门到精通

阿里云服务器搭建网站全攻略,涵盖从入门到精通的步骤。详细讲解如何选择服务器、配置环境、部署网站,包括域名解析、安全设置、性能优化等关键环节,助你轻松搭建稳定、高效的网络...

阿里云服务器搭建网站全攻略,涵盖从入门到精通的步骤。详细讲解如何选择服务器、配置环境、部署网站,包括域名解析、安全设置、性能优化等关键环节,助你轻松搭建稳定、高效的网络空间。

随着互联网的快速发展,网站已经成为企业展示形象、拓展业务的重要平台,阿里云作为国内领先的云计算服务商,为用户提供稳定、安全、高效的云服务器,本文将详细介绍如何使用阿里云服务器搭建网站,帮助您轻松入门。

准备工作

1、注册阿里云账号:登录阿里云官网(https://www.aliyun.com/),点击“免费注册”,按照提示完成注册。

2、购买云服务器:登录阿里云账号,进入“产品与服务”页面,选择“弹性计算”下的“ECS(云服务器)”,然后根据实际需求选择合适的配置和带宽。

3、购买域名:登录阿里云账号,进入“产品与服务”页面,选择“域名”下的“域名注册”,然后选择合适的域名进行购买。

4、配置SSL证书:为了保障网站安全,建议购买SSL证书,登录阿里云账号,进入“产品与服务”页面,选择“安全”下的“SSL证书”,然后购买适合的证书。

阿里云服务器怎么搭建网站的,阿里云服务器搭建网站全攻略,从入门到精通

搭建网站

1、登录云服务器:购买云服务器后,阿里云会发送短信或邮件告知您的登录信息,登录云服务器后,使用SSH客户端(如PuTTY)连接到服务器。

2、安装LAMP环境:LAMP是指Linux、Apache、MySQL和PHP的缩写,是搭建网站的基础环境,以下以CentOS 7为例,介绍如何安装LAMP环境。

(1)安装Apache:在服务器终端输入以下命令,安装Apache服务。

yum install httpd

(2)启动Apache服务:在服务器终端输入以下命令,启动Apache服务。

systemctl start httpd

(3)设置Apache服务开机自启:在服务器终端输入以下命令,设置Apache服务开机自启。

systemctl enable httpd

(4)测试Apache服务:在浏览器中输入您的公网IP地址,查看Apache默认页面,确认Apache服务安装成功。

3、安装MySQL:在服务器终端输入以下命令,安装MySQL数据库。

yum install mariadb mariadb-server

(1)启动MySQL服务:在服务器终端输入以下命令,启动MySQL服务。

阿里云服务器怎么搭建网站的,阿里云服务器搭建网站全攻略,从入门到精通

systemctl start mariadb

(2)设置MySQL服务开机自启:在服务器终端输入以下命令,设置MySQL服务开机自启。

systemctl enable mariadb

(3)配置MySQL安全:登录MySQL,执行以下命令,修改root密码并删除匿名用户。

mysql_secure_installation

4、安装PHP:在服务器终端输入以下命令,安装PHP。

yum install php php-mysql

5、配置PHP与MySQL:在服务器终端输入以下命令,修改PHP配置文件。

vi /etc/php.ini

找到以下行,取消注释并修改:

;mysql.default_socket=/var/run/mysqld/mysqld.sock
mysql.default_socket=/var/lib/mysql/mysql.sock

找到以下行,取消注释并修改:

;mysql.default_host=localhost
mysql.default_host=127.0.0.1

重启Apache服务,使配置生效。

6、安装网站程序:将您的网站程序上传到服务器,通常使用FTP客户端或SSH客户端上传,以下以WordPress为例,介绍如何安装WordPress。

阿里云服务器怎么搭建网站的,阿里云服务器搭建网站全攻略,从入门到精通

(1)解压网站程序:在服务器终端输入以下命令,解压网站程序。

tar -zxvf wp-content.tar.gz

(2)创建数据库:登录MySQL,创建数据库和用户。

CREATE DATABASE your_database_name;
C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password';
GRANT ALL PRIVILEGES ON your_database_name.* TO 'your_username'@'localhost';
FLUSH PRIVILEGES;

(3)配置网站程序:将网站程序中的wp-config-sample.php文件重命名为wp-config.php,并编辑该文件,填写数据库信息。

(4)访问网站:在浏览器中输入您的域名或公网IP地址,访问网站程序安装向导,完成网站安装。

通过以上步骤,您已经成功在阿里云服务器上搭建了一个网站,在实际应用中,您可能需要根据需求安装其他软件,如Redis、Memcached等,为了保证网站安全,建议定期备份数据库和网站程序,并关注阿里云官方动态,了解最新的云服务器优化方案,祝您网站运行顺利!

黑狐家游戏

发表评论

最新文章